Originally Posted by errol I am reading Max Hastings "Overlord". It makes it plain that the Germans put up a tremendous defence considering they were outgunned, outnumbered, with no Luftwaffe, OKW nuttered by Hitler, most of their best units tied up or destroyed in Russia. Could the Allies have invaded Europe successfully without the Russian Front or would the Germans, particularly their SS Panzer Groups have given us another belting and thrown us back into the sea? |
To be honest the Germans could have had their entire army parked on the Eastern Front and Overload would not have taken place had the Luftwaffe maintained air superiority over the channel instead of being smeared all over southern England.
